2010 Annual Sacred Peace Walk
Las Vegas to the Nevada Test Site
A Communal Pilgrimage to America's Nuclear Sacrifice Zone
March 29 to April 5
The 63 mile journey is a walking meditation. Most people camp with help from a Las Vegas support team though other accommodations are possible.
Part-time "pilgrims" welcome.
Come, let the desert's power inspire you!
Organized by Nevada Desert Experience: Interfaith Resistance to Nuclear Weapons and War

Orientation is March 29 at the Las Vegas Catholic Worker. We mainly walk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day and Saturday with Friday spent in Indian Springs vigiling, reflecting, resting and rejuvenating. Some walkers may risk arrest at either Creech AFB (Friday or Monday) or at the Nevada Test Site (Sunday or Monday). Not everyone "crosses the line" (though all who walk are inherently line-crossers).
Registering beforehand helps us prepare well. Thank you for giving us a heads up. Suggested donation is $150 (sliding scale); pro-rate freely as you need.
Gathering pledges like a walk-a-thon is a great way to raise money...and awareness! NDE is a small-staffed, low-budget operation. This is an "easy sell" to get sponsors, and is an important source of support for NDE throughout the year. Non-walkers are encouraged to sponsor someone else.
We walk in the footsteps of a long legacy of peace walkers and spiritual leaders to draw attention to the nuclear dangers that continue to threaten our sacred planet and the community of life. We come to heal this, the most bombed place on Earth.
